Background technique
Fly ash autoclaved brick production technology include raw material processing preparation, by a certain percentage batching, stir, disappear
Change, rolling, compression moulding, the quiet several big step Zou fly ash autoclaved bricks such as maintenance, steam press maintenance, product inspection and stacking that stop of code base are
With flyash, lime is that primary raw material (can also add proper amount of gypsum and aggregate) prepares, compression moulding through blank.Through still kettle
Steam pressure, materials for wall made of autoclave curing, color are in black gray expandable.Fly ash autoclaved brick is mainly used for load bearing wall, because of weight
Gently also can be used as adding for frame structure fills material to amount, has the characteristics that lightweight, heat preservation, heat-insulated, processable, shortening construction period,
The product can either digest a large amount of flyash, and farmland saving reduces pollution, protect environment.

The present invention also provides a kind of application methods of new green environment protection building materials steam pressure production equipment, specifically include following step
It is rapid:
S1, upper cover is opened after opening door-plate, by the inside of transverse slat extraction third groove, the material to steam pressure is placed on cross
Plate;
S2, the inside that the transverse slat after placement material is pushed into third groove, close upper cover, door-plate are then switched off, by card
Button is connected together with boss;
S3, the first pipe by being equipped with are introduced steam into the inner bottom of cabinet, and steam can be logical by what is offered
Hole rises to the material to steam pressure upwards;
S4, motor is opened, motor work will drive shaft rotation, and shaft will drive square plate rotation;
S5, steam can be again introduced by the second pipe being equipped with to the inside of cabinet after material.
